COBY NINE; First foal of a modest hudles and flat winner. Yard employing a proper jockey for a change but are pretty poor in bumpers.

DARK EPISODE; Related to five NH winners but none won their bumper and this one may be a longer term project. Yard in a rich vein of form but this one looks to be the second string on jockey bookings.

ENRILO; Yard have an excellent record in bumpers but tend not to start the better ones here. Dam a modest maiden as is the only sibling to date.

HOLD THE NOTE; Dam a modest maiden but some encouragement from a hurdles winning sibling. Starting out in a hot race and may find a few too good.

JAKAMANI; Half brother to the very useful Kentford Grey Lady who won her bumper at the first attempt. Lovely pedigree as you would expect from this yard and worth keeping a close eye on in the betting.

JOHNNY ROCCO; Dam won her bumper and this one showed promise on bumper debut. Wore earplugs that day so may have one or two quirks.

NINTH WAVE; Dam a flat winner at up to 13f. Easy winner of a Bitterly Point and has joined a top table that is in fine form. Hard to overlook with the champion jockey on board.

POISON ARROW; Dam a useful flat winner at up to 11f. 32,000EU 3yo and small west country yard are 2/9 in bumpers. Chances each way at likely decent odds.

WINNINGSEVERYTHING; Half brother to the useful Edmund Kean and Brave Vic plus two other bumper winners. Top connections paid 80,000EU and likely to be forward enough on debut.

DANCING GREY; three trys in bumpers, 3rd on latest but that looks some way short of what will be required here.

LITTLE ROBIN; Well beaten on bumper debut and that is the likely outcome again.


Sel; WINNINGSEVERYTHING

EW; POISON ARROW
